Jewelry doesn't lie! Women have gone from being "those who are given jewelry" to "those who actively purchase it ", and they are the ones who nowadays choose which side of themselves they would like to show, or, quite simply, their mood at a given moment in time.
An emancipation of social codes has liberated jewels as much as the woman who wears them. Wedding rings are no longer reserved for married people, pearl necklaces are no longer the privilege of the bourgeoisie and christening medals no longer necessarily have the same meaning for everyone.
Jewelry in its own way speaks about social identity. But beyond the conscious messages they deliver, jewels are part of our history and can reveal our unconscious personality. Discreet or ostentatious, they express our tastes and our relationship to femininity, they bear witness to our family or love history. Deciphering a complex relationship, rich in meaning.
So how can the role of the long necklace (or "sautoir") be given a philosophical interpretation?
In times gone by, a "sautoir" was part of a knight's harness, used as a stirrup to jump on his horse.

The shape of the necklace with which one jumped on the horse gave us the word in French for a long necklace..."sautoir".
A sautoir is a jewel whose ribbon and chain are passed around the neck to fall at a given point on the chest.
Every long necklace or sautoir symbolizes the responsibilities of those who wear them, as well as their authority.
Sautoir, in French refers to a long or semi-long necklace, of about 50cm, which can be worn at its full length or wrapped around the neck.
The necklace consists of a chain, suggesting the chain of attachment, oppression and boredom, of the past linking us to something unchanging.
The pendant, on the contrary, offers a ray of color, shape, freedom, radiance and femininity.
The necklace has become a way for a woman to assert herself as a free woman, definitively ready to seduce.
